Selection of advanced wastewater treatment process for pulp and paper industry based on the fuzzy analytical hierarchy process methods
|
Abstract:
The best choice of advanced wastewater treatment (AWT) processes for pulp and paper industry is a multi-criteria decision problem. An analysis was made on the three kinds of AWT processes: coagulation sedimentation/flotation and filtration, Fenton method and ecological treatment by establishment of the evaluation criteria system including economic benefit, technical performance, management effect and social effect. Analytic hierarchy process was used to calculate the weights of evaluation criteria system, where technical performance ranks first among the indices followed by investment cost. In combination with fuzzy mathematics method, a comprehensive evaluation was made for the three AWT processes regarding their merits and shortcomings and the selection of the best process was determined by ranking finally. As a case study, an objective suggestion for selection of the best AWT process was put forward for two pulp and paper industries considering the expected value of the decision-makers and the actual situation of two industries.
